#AAA184 Hex color

#AAA184

The hexadecimal color code #AAA184 corresponds to the code RGB( 170, 161, 132 ). It's a shade of Yellow. This color is a combination of red (at 0,67 level), green (at 0,63 level) and blue (at 0,52 level). Its brightness is 59% and its saturation is 18%. It is composed of red at 36%, green at 34% and blue at 28%.
